Before posting, each Tripadvisor review goes through an automated tracking system, which collects information, answering the following questions: how, what, where and when. If the system detects something that potentially contradicts our community guidelines, the review is not published.
When the system detects a problem, a review may be automatically rejected, sent to the reviewer for validation, or manually reviewed by our team of content specialists, who work 24/7 to maintain the quality of the reviews on our site.
Our team checks each review posted on the site disputed by our community as not meeting our community guidelines.

We had a great experience touring Cassis with Christopher Curtis. We found him on the site Tours by Locals. Christopher met us at port as we disembarked from our cruise ship. We had a group of 14 with a mix of adults, teenagers, and children. Christopher had a clean, air conditioned vehicle waiting and took us to Cassis. He had arranged transport into the town, as large vehicles are not permitted to drive into the town. Christopher was very accommodating to all of our requests, and was flexible in the schedule. After Cassis, he took us to a spectacular spot overlooking the village to take pictures. He also took pictures with his camera, as he is a photographer, and emailed them to us after the tour. Once we returned to port, he arranged special transport back the ship for a member of our party who is handicap. All in all a wonderful day, and Christopher made it very easy. I would highly recommend him!
